These requirements are based on the findings of the PACT Analysis. Each requirement will be graded with the MoSCoW approach: 1 - Must haves 2 - Should haves 3 - Could haves 4 - Won't haves, in which 1 is very important and essential to the project, 2 has second priority, 3 will only be developed if there is time left and 4 will not be developed.
Requirement | Description | MoSCoW |
---|---|---|
Interactive video | Make the video using XIMPEL. | 1 - Must |
Make application bug free | The application should be bug free, so it can run of a while without maintenance. | 2 - Should |
Make sure the game is quick and easy | The targets are young and do not want to spend too much time on their decisions. | 2 - Should |
Implement sound in the videos | This is not a must, we can do this if there is time left. The game will work and be clear if there is no sound in the game. | 3 - Could |
Do not make the game too long | If the game is too long, people will lose interest. | 1 - Must |
Do not make the game too hard | If the players find that some options are too hard to find, they will get frustrated and quit the game. | 2 - Should |
Make the application accessible for mobile devices (mobile site) | If there is time left, it would be cool to make the application playable on the mobile phone. | 3 - Could |
Create a contact page | If there are bugs to report, the players must be able to report them through a contact from. | 2 - Should |
